Shareholding results refer to the distribution of ownership stakes in a company as disclosed in financial reports. These results provide insights into who holds shares, including institutional and retail investors, and can indicate trends in investor confidence. Analyzing shareholding results helps stakeholders understand the company’s ownership dynamics and potential market influence. Heads Up Ventures has released its latest shareholding reports, covering the Second quarter and the fiscal year ending on (Q2-Sep 2024-2025).This detailed report examines who owns shares, including Promoters, promoter groups, Foreign investors, public investors, and government entities.
Shareholder Name Previous Quarter Quantity Current Quarter Quantity Previous Quarter Shares(in %) Current Quarter Shares(in %) Quarter to Quarter Difference
Promoters 29.94 Lakh 29.94 Lakh 13.56 13.56 0
Public 1.91 Cr 1.91 Cr 85.8 85.8 0
DII 49.54 K 49.54 K 0.22 0.22 0
FII 93.13 K 93.13 K 0.42 0.42 0
Government 0 0 0 0 0
Promoters shareholding remained stable, at 13.56% in both June 2024 and September 2024. This indicates that the promoters’ control over the company did not change during this period. Public shareholding remained consistent, holding steady at 85.8% in both June 2024 and September 2024. This indicates that the Public control over the company did not change during this period. DIIs (Domestic Institutional Investors) shareholding remained unchanged at 0.22% from June 2024 to September 2024. This indicates that domestic institutions maintained their investment level in the company. FIIs (Foreign Institutional Investors) shareholding remained at 0.42% from June 2024 to September 2024. , indicating no change in the investment levels by foreign institutions in the company.
